Phillips Edison & Company (PECO) Operating Leases (2010 - 2026)
Phillips Edison & Company's (PECO) quarterly Operating Leases came in at $123.1 million in Q1 2026, up 4.11% year-on-year from $118.3 million in Q1 2025, and up 4.02% quarter-over-quarter from $118.4 million in Q4 2025.
